Handover Note — Regional Sales Review

Theo, here's where things stand as you take over the eastern region. The Danbrook accounts are solid, Pellick territory needs love — Rina's team missed quota two quarters running, mostly a coverage problem, not effort. The Orvale distributor renewal lands in six weeks; don't let it drift. I've scheduled the sales leads for a joint review the first Tuesday after you start. One more thing: keep the following strictly within this group, as it shapes everything above.

board note of kagep-yahig: Only 9 of the 120 pilot accounts renewed Quenix, so a churn review is set for April 1.

## Changelog — Stormcall Fan-Out v3.8.1

Rotated the signing credentials used by the weather-alert fan-out workers after the quarterly audit flagged the previous pair as past its rotation window. No alerts were affected; the old key remained valid during a two-hour overlap and has now been revoked. On-call: if downstream relays report signature rejections, confirm they pulled the updated trust bundle before escalating, since stale caches were the cause of both false alarms last quarter. The newly active key is recorded below.

release key, yagap-kagag: bky6_1ks93y

This alert fires when the internal `tailfox` log-tailing CLI reports elevated stream-drop rates from the Corvid log broker. Users will see gaps or stalled tails rather than outright failures, so expect confused reports before the dashboard catches up. First, check broker consumer lag on the Corvid panel; second, verify the tailfox gateway pods aren't restarting. A rollback of the last gateway deploy resolves most incidents. If drops persist past 20 minutes or affect audit-critical streams, notify the observability maintainers right away.

escalation mailbox, bafog-fafog: ulador@paliqlabs.internal

Runbook: flaky integration tests — Coinbright payments service.

The ledger-settlement suite intermittently fails when the Vaultmere sandbox lags on auth handshakes. First, retry the suite once; most flakes clear. If failures persist, restart the sandbox pod and purge the stale session cache. Escalate to the Coinbright platform rotation only after two clean retries fail. Attach logs and include the trace token shown below.

pipeline stamp: htk31_f769b577b3028a4e9958e5bb8d1259a